技术文摘
清晰函数名称的力量,干净代码不可或缺
清晰函数名称的力量,干净代码不可或缺
在软件开发的世界里,代码就如同建筑的基石,支撑着整个软件系统的运行。而清晰的函数名称,则是这基石中至关重要的一部分,是实现干净代码不可或缺的要素。
清晰的函数名称具有强大的表现力。当我们在阅读一段代码时,函数名称就像是一个个路标,指引着我们理解代码的功能和逻辑。一个好的函数名称能够准确地传达函数的意图,让开发者在不深入研究函数具体实现的情况下,就能快速了解其作用。例如,一个名为“calculateTotalPrice”的函数,很明显是用于计算总价格的,这样的名称直观易懂,大大提高了代码的可读性。
清晰的函数名称有助于提高代码的可维护性。在软件开发过程中,代码往往需要不断地修改和完善。如果函数名称模糊不清,当其他开发者或者我们自己在后续对代码进行维护时,就会花费大量的时间去理解函数的功能,甚至可能因为误解而引入新的错误。而清晰的函数名称能够让维护者迅速定位问题,准确地进行修改和优化,减少出错的概率。
清晰的函数名称也能提升团队协作的效率。在一个开发团队中,不同的成员可能负责不同的模块和功能。清晰的函数名称可以让团队成员之间更好地理解彼此的代码,方便进行代码的集成和协作。大家可以根据函数名称快速了解其他成员编写的函数的作用,从而更好地进行沟通和合作。
要做到函数名称清晰,需要遵循一定的命名规范。名称应该具有描述性,避免使用过于简单或者模糊的词汇;采用有意义的命名方式,如动词加名词的形式来表示函数的操作和对象;同时,要保持命名的一致性,让整个代码库的函数名称风格统一。
清晰的函数名称是干净代码的重要组成部分。它不仅能够提高代码的可读性、可维护性和团队协作效率,还能让我们的软件开发工作更加高效和顺畅。让我们重视函数名称的命名,发挥其强大的力量,打造出高质量的代码。
- PyQt6 中的列表框与树形视图:你是否真正知晓其使用之道?
- Body-Parser:用于格式化 Express 请求体数据的三方库
- 渗透测试与漏洞扫描开源自动化方案详解
- 2024 年 Node.js 之十款精选工具库,助力项目开发轻松启程
- 十个前端鲜为人知却实用的工具函数库
- Python 匿名大师之 lambda 函数使用技巧全解
- C 语言中 cJSON 与结构体的转换方法
- 别用 BeanUtils.copyProperties 为何会翻车
- 一网打尽 16 个 CSS @ 规则
- C++异常处理机制中 try-catch-throw 的作用与实践深度剖析
- 推荐六大前端自动化测试框架,助力提升开发效率与质量
- C#多线程开发:线程同步的深度探索与实例剖析
- 设计模式之享元模式全解析
- 前端开发中 Visual Studio Code 与 Visual Studio 的抉择
- FFmpeg 前端视频合成实操